Shriver Grabs Weekly Honors Again
Oct. 20, 2008
CHAPEL HILL, N.C. - North Carolina senior forward Brian Shriver was honored by TopDrawerSoccer.com for the second straight week with a spot on the website's Men's College Soccer National Team of the Week. Shriver led the Tar Heels to an unbeaten week with three goals in wins over William & Mary and Virginia Tech. Shriver, who leads the Atlantic Coast Conference with 12 goals this season, scored twice in Tuesday's 4-1 win over William & Mary. The Clearwater, Fla., product netted Carolina's first two scores against the Tribe, including his ACC-best fourth game-winner in the 39th minute. In Saturday's victory over Virginia Tech, Shriver buried the Tar Heels' second goal in the 43rd minute. Shriver, who has three multi-goal games in the Tar Heels' last six contests, leads UNC with 25 points on 12 goals and an assist.
